What is another word for online demand publishing?

Pronunciation: [ˈɒnla͡ɪn dɪmˈand pˈʌblɪʃɪŋ] (IPA)

Online demand publishing refers to the process of publishing books or other written materials based on customer requests, rather than printing a set number of copies in advance. This allows for more efficient and cost-effective publishing, as well as for greater customization to individual consumer preferences. Some synonyms for this term might include print-on-demand, self-publishing, online printing, or custom publishing. These terms all capture the idea of offering targeted publication services that can be tailored to meet the needs of a specific audience.
